DeepSeek believed for 19 seconds before responding to the concern, "Are you smarter than Gemini?" Then, it provided a whopper: DeepSeek thought it was ChatGPT.

This apparently innocuous error could be proof - a smoking gun per se - that, yes, DeepSeek was trained on OpenAI models, as has actually been claimed by OpenAI, wiki-tb-service.com and that when pressed, it will dive back into that training to speak its fact.

However, when asked point blank by another TechRadar editor, "Are you ChatGPT?" it said it was not which it is "DeepSeek-V3, an AI assistant developed exclusively by the Chinese Company DeepSeek."

Okay, sure, however in your rather prolonged reaction to me, you, DeepSeek, made multiple recommendations to yourself as ChatGPT. I have actually consisted of some screenshots below as proof:

As you can see, after attempting to recognize if I was discussing Gemini AI or some other Gemini, DeepSeek replies, "If it's about the AI, then the concern is comparing me (which is ChatGPT) to Gemini." Later, it describes "Myself (ChatGPT)."

Why would DeepSeek do that under any scenarios? Is it one of those AI hallucinations we like to speak about? Perhaps, however in my interaction, DeepSeek appeared quite clear about its identity.

I got to this line of questions, by the method, because I asked Gemini on my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ra if it's smarter than DeepSeek. The response was shockingly diplomatic, and when I asked for a simple yes or no response, it informed me, "It's not possible to offer a basic yes or no response. 'Smart' is too complicated a principle to use in that way to language models. They have various strengths and weak points."

I can't state I disagree. In fact, DeepSeek's response was rather comparable, except it was not necessarily speaking about itself.

This does not build up

I think I have actually been clear about my DeepSeek skepticism. Everyone says it's the most powerful and cheaply qualified AI ever (everybody other than Alibaba), but I don't know if that holds true. To be reasonable, there's an incredible quantity of detail on GitHub about DeekSeek's open-source LLMs. They at least appear to show that DeepSeek did the work.

But I do not think they expose how these models were trained. In either case, I do not have evidence that DeepSeek trained its designs on OpenAI or wiki.vifm.info anyone else's big language designs - or a minimum of I didn't till today.

Who are you?

DeepSeek is progressively a mystery covered inside a conundrum. There is some agreement on the truth that DeepSeek got here more totally formed and in less time than many other models, consisting of Google Gemini, OpenAI's ChatGPT, and Claude AI.

Very couple of in the tech community trust DeepSeek's apps on smartphones since there is no way to know if China is looking at all that timely data. On the other hand, the designs DeepSeek has built are impressive, and some, consisting of Microsoft, are already preparing to include them in their own AI offerings.

When it comes to Microsoft, fishtanklive.wiki there is some paradox here. Copilot was built based upon cutting-edge ChatGPT models, but in recent months, there have actually been some questions about if the deep monetary collaboration in between Microsoft and OpenAI will last into the Agentic and later Artificial General Intelligence age.

So what if Microsoft starts utilizing DeepSeek, which is possibly just another offshoot of its current if not future, pal OpenAI?

The entire thing sounds like a confusing mess - and in the meantime, DeepSeek seemingly has an id.
